<feed xmlns='http://www.w3.org/2005/Atom'>
<title>blackbird-hostboot/src/usr/trace/runtime/makefile, branch 07-25-2019</title>
<subtitle>Blackbird™ hostboot sources</subtitle>
<id>https://git.raptorcs.com/git/blackbird-hostboot/atom?h=07-25-2019</id>
<link rel='self' href='https://git.raptorcs.com/git/blackbird-hostboot/atom?h=07-25-2019'/>
<link rel='alternate' type='text/html' href='https://git.raptorcs.com/git/blackbird-hostboot/'/>
<updated>2018-06-19T21:24:07+00:00</updated>
<entry>
<title>Create a utility to add/remove entries from a link list within a given buffer</title>
<updated>2018-06-19T21:24:07+00:00</updated>
<author>
<name>Roland Veloz</name>
<email>rveloz@us.ibm.com</email>
</author>
<published>2018-05-30T16:18:42+00:00</published>
<link rel='alternate' type='text/html' href='https://git.raptorcs.com/git/blackbird-hostboot/commit/?id=0189e34d3bbc3ce77e1242c94750f99ef0d58d90'/>
<id>urn:sha1:0189e34d3bbc3ce77e1242c94750f99ef0d58d90</id>
<content type='text'>
This buffer is designed to be used in a runtime environment.

I am laying the ground work for an over arching story that will
save traces in a buffer for future consumption.

For this commit, I have created the methods necessary to add, remove and find
available space (for an Entry) in a buffer bound region of memory using a
circular, doubly linked list.

Change-Id: I259bb0f6051611a17b7b919bf026919ffdb12eb1
RTC: 191303
Reviewed-on: http://ralgit01.raleigh.ibm.com/gerrit1/59575
Tested-by: Jenkins Server &lt;pfd-jenkins+hostboot@us.ibm.com&gt;
Tested-by: Jenkins OP Build CI &lt;op-jenkins+hostboot@us.ibm.com&gt;
Tested-by: Jenkins OP HW &lt;op-hw-jenkins+hostboot@us.ibm.com&gt;
Reviewed-by: Prachi Gupta &lt;pragupta@us.ibm.com&gt;
Reviewed-by: Christian R. Geddes &lt;crgeddes@us.ibm.com&gt;
Tested-by: FSP CI Jenkins &lt;fsp-CI-jenkins+hostboot@us.ibm.com&gt;
Reviewed-by: Daniel M. Crowell &lt;dcrowell@us.ibm.com&gt;
</content>
</entry>
<entry>
<title>HBRT Reserved Mem Trace Buffer implementation.</title>
<updated>2018-06-19T21:24:01+00:00</updated>
<author>
<name>Sakethan R Kotta</name>
<email>sakkotta@in.ibm.com</email>
</author>
<published>2018-03-29T12:10:59+00:00</published>
<link rel='alternate' type='text/html' href='https://git.raptorcs.com/git/blackbird-hostboot/commit/?id=1ec6201b896c5cbc22fef03df1a063faa8cd6411'/>
<id>urn:sha1:1ec6201b896c5cbc22fef03df1a063faa8cd6411</id>
<content type='text'>
-Hostboot master Drawer will create TRACEBUF section in the HB
 Rsvd Mem and HBRT, while booting, gets the TRACEBUF section
 details and initializes the circual buffer, if available.
-If a valid data is present in the buffer, HBRT will create an
 info log ERRL, otherwise initializes the buffer.
-Traces from all components are serialized and stored in the
 single TRACEBUF in the same format (fsp-binary Trace). When
 buffer is full, it deletes the oldest entry/entries to store
 the new ones.
-ERRL-&gt;collectTrace() works similar to other buffers.
-A new test case is added to dump the traces from TRACEBUF.

Change-Id: I4ce943231a2ba30e3a13ca34d1c40ff68464a994
RTC:188726
RTC:191302
Reviewed-on: http://ralgit01.raleigh.ibm.com/gerrit1/56450
Reviewed-by: Prachi Gupta &lt;pragupta@us.ibm.com&gt;
Reviewed-by: Daniel M. Crowell &lt;dcrowell@us.ibm.com&gt;
Tested-by: Daniel M. Crowell &lt;dcrowell@us.ibm.com&gt;
</content>
</entry>
<entry>
<title>Log traces to error logs in HBRT</title>
<updated>2017-10-20T02:17:55+00:00</updated>
<author>
<name>Matt Derksen</name>
<email>mderkse1@us.ibm.com</email>
</author>
<published>2017-10-03T16:02:13+00:00</published>
<link rel='alternate' type='text/html' href='https://git.raptorcs.com/git/blackbird-hostboot/commit/?id=ad1909dedffab93922fe80f06bf89d5b76d9e9a0'/>
<id>urn:sha1:ad1909dedffab93922fe80f06bf89d5b76d9e9a0</id>
<content type='text'>
This enables buffer tracing at hostboot runtime.
Will add these traces to runtime errors for better debug

Change-Id: I795bb7deafdd02adea4588ebf8dfb11cbce116a0
RTC:172770
Reviewed-on: http://ralgit01.raleigh.ibm.com/gerrit1/48084
Tested-by: Jenkins Server &lt;pfd-jenkins+hostboot@us.ibm.com&gt;
Reviewed-by: Christian R. Geddes &lt;crgeddes@us.ibm.com&gt;
Tested-by: Jenkins OP Build CI &lt;op-jenkins+hostboot@us.ibm.com&gt;
Tested-by: Jenkins OP HW &lt;op-hw-jenkins+hostboot@us.ibm.com&gt;
Tested-by: FSP CI Jenkins &lt;fsp-CI-jenkins+hostboot@us.ibm.com&gt;
Reviewed-by: Martin Gloff &lt;mgloff@us.ibm.com&gt;
Reviewed-by: Daniel M. Crowell &lt;dcrowell@us.ibm.com&gt;
</content>
</entry>
<entry>
<title>Change copyright prolog for all files to Apache.</title>
<updated>2014-05-22T03:16:32+00:00</updated>
<author>
<name>Patrick Williams</name>
<email>iawillia@us.ibm.com</email>
</author>
<published>2014-05-19T21:51:08+00:00</published>
<link rel='alternate' type='text/html' href='https://git.raptorcs.com/git/blackbird-hostboot/commit/?id=aa0446e9d1c2f0fb17a6ef40b689ec7281d65387'/>
<id>urn:sha1:aa0446e9d1c2f0fb17a6ef40b689ec7281d65387</id>
<content type='text'>
Change-Id: I5664587b4f889099290ef50d50fa9ce5e580e1eb
Reviewed-on: http://gfw160.aus.stglabs.ibm.com:8080/gerrit/11167
Tested-by: Jenkins Server
Reviewed-by: A. Patrick Williams III &lt;iawillia@us.ibm.com&gt;
</content>
</entry>
<entry>
<title>Update makefiles &amp; included .mk files to use += convention.</title>
<updated>2014-05-21T22:32:37+00:00</updated>
<author>
<name>Brian Silver</name>
<email>bsilver@us.ibm.com</email>
</author>
<published>2014-05-20T19:17:34+00:00</published>
<link rel='alternate' type='text/html' href='https://git.raptorcs.com/git/blackbird-hostboot/commit/?id=42e2de679d889a35d67ff0be4f5433ef3b495ff7'/>
<id>urn:sha1:42e2de679d889a35d67ff0be4f5433ef3b495ff7</id>
<content type='text'>
Change-Id: I4148bc4c770b7c3c10fe25aa18d57d1a4301e5a9
Reviewed-on: http://gfw160.aus.stglabs.ibm.com:8080/gerrit/11194
Tested-by: Jenkins Server
Reviewed-by: Christopher T. Phan &lt;cphan@us.ibm.com&gt;
Reviewed-by: A. Patrick Williams III &lt;iawillia@us.ibm.com&gt;
</content>
</entry>
<entry>
<title>Initial Hostboot Runtime image support.</title>
<updated>2013-09-17T21:45:31+00:00</updated>
<author>
<name>Patrick Williams</name>
<email>iawillia@us.ibm.com</email>
</author>
<published>2013-07-16T20:29:15+00:00</published>
<link rel='alternate' type='text/html' href='https://git.raptorcs.com/git/blackbird-hostboot/commit/?id=5652d7c0c6a8db05699f2b4334e4615e1ba22127'/>
<id>urn:sha1:5652d7c0c6a8db05699f2b4334e4615e1ba22127</id>
<content type='text'>
RTC: 76675
Change-Id: Ibd21cf5b555e6dcee182a2f1a292b47d4f384ba0
Reviewed-on: http://gfw160.austin.ibm.com:8080/gerrit/6127
Tested-by: Jenkins Server
Reviewed-by: A. Patrick Williams III &lt;iawillia@us.ibm.com&gt;
</content>
</entry>
</feed>
